中文摘要: |
目的 探讨浸润性导管癌(IDC)时间-信号强度曲线(TIC)及ADC值与组织学分级的相关性。方法 回顾性分析43例(共45个病灶)经病理学证实为IDC的动态增强MRI及DWI表现,测量肿块的早期强化率、ADC值,描绘时间-信号强度曲线(TIC),对不同病理学分级IDC的早期强化率、TIC曲线分型及ADC值进行组间比较,并分析其与病理组织分级的相关性。结果 43例IDC中,Ⅰ级8例,Ⅱ级24例,Ⅲ级11例。不同级别IDC两两比较,早期强化率的差异均无统计学意义(P均>0.05),而TIC曲线分型、ADC值的差异均有统计学意义(P均<0.05),IDC的TIC曲线分型与病理组织学分级呈正相关关系(r=0.40,P<0.01),与ADC值呈负相关(r=-0.79,P<0.01)。正常乳腺组织与不同病理组织分级IDC的ADC值差异均有统计学意义(P均<0.05)。结论 乳腺动态增强MRI的TIC曲线结合ADC值可在一定程度上预测IDC的组织学分级。 |
英文摘要: |
Objective To explore the correlation of time-signal intensity curve (TIC) and ADC values with histopathologic classification in patients with invasive ductal carcinoma (IDC) of the breast. Methods Forty-three patients with IDC (45 lesions) confirmed by histopathology were retrospectively analyzed. All of them underwent dynamic enhancement MRI and DWI, and then the ADC values and the early enhancement rate of tumors were measured and the TIC were obtained. The difference of ADC values, early enhancement rate and TIC types among different pathological grading of IDC were compared, and their relationship with the pathological grading were analyzed. Results In 43 cases of IDC, 8 cases of grade Ⅰ, 24 cases of grade Ⅱ, and 11 cases of grade Ⅲ. Compared between any two gradings of IDC, there was no significant difference for the early enhancement rate (both P>0.05), while there was significant difference for the ADC values and TIC types (all P<0.05). There was negative correlation between histopathologic grading and ADC value (r=-0.79,P<0.01), and there was positive correlation between histopathologic grading and TIC types (r=0.40, P<0.01). The differences of ADC value between normal breast tissue and IDC with different grading were significant (all P<0.05). Conclusion The TIC curve of dynamic enhancement MRI combine with ADC value can be used to forecast pathological grading of IDC. |
